About this site

Sha'ab Maksur is an elongated reef on the exposed outer edge of Fury Shoals, famed for its dramatic vertical walls dropping into the blue and a southern plateau swept by current. Its open-water position draws pelagic action: oceanic whitetip and grey reef sharks, occasional hammerheads, dolphins and even whale sharks. The steep east and west walls are encrusted with vibrant soft corals and gorgonians.
